How it started:

When I started I had about 2 million banked because I went nuclear on resources before quitting last time and upgraded a bunch of pointless stands. I was already at PTF and VMAN Lab so in short the goal is +98 million credits

Available achievement money on this journey: 2.25 million for being above 75 million (guaranteed to hit this), 1.25 million if my player value ever surpasses 100 million (unlikely). Other achievements like playing in top leagues are not expected but a welcome influx.

How it's going:

I currently have about 2 million banked and around 37 million credits worth of players in the squad excluding home grown players which contribute another 6 million in value. Realistically if I were to sell the entire squad right now I would probably make about 25-30 million so we're looking at roughly 25% of the way there. If everyone goes for the values they are transfer listed for then that number rises to around 40 million. Ultimately this is complete guess work but being 25% of the way there sounds between than 2% of the way there for 3.5 months of effort

Playing one season in the top division in Brazil definitely gave some good gate revenue (2 mil), a usual season is around 1.2 to 1.5 million with weekly wages coming to around 0.5 million. Allowing an average of 0.1 mil per season for repairs that means the average profit per season with no player trades would be 0.6 to 0.9 million. Going exclusively off revenue it would take 100 seasons to reach WCTF (Assuming that I require 75 million and we average out profit to 0.75 million per season)

What's Next:
  • Giving up on the home grown strategy for the time being. I will integrate good youths that come through but I am planning to phase out any players training under 110, I have already culled those averaging below 100. As long as I have a small rotation of players coming through from youth I should be able to cut required costs on players and look for higher profit margins rather than players that are necessary to fill gaps
  • Aim for 80%+ ROI on players that have played for many seasons when they start to reach 28-30 years old or as I bring in younger replacements, profit is preferred but wherever possible preserve as much value as I can
  • Work on improving training scores in the youth team - hitting the 15% penalty far too often but then even when I do training matches I seem to get streaks of horrible training too (I have seen the standard training guide but I want to form my own opinions and customize to my squad instead)
  • Senior Squad: Bring in new DR, ML and FR, the current oldest in my squad, try to offload the aging players that already have replacements lined up, try to offload the previously mentioned positions when I find suitable replacements
  • Youth Squad: Bring in players 16-19 with high training, currently GK, DC and FR are 6 months away from potentially being integrated into the senior squad
